| Description: | WestEd, a nonprofit research, development, and service agency, works with education and other communities to promote excellence, achieve equity, and improve learning for children, youth, and adults. While WestEd serves the states of Arizona, California, Nevada, and Utah as one of the nation's Regional Educational Laboratories, our agency's work extends throughout the United States and abroad. WestEd has 16 offices nationwide, from Washington and Boston to Arizona, Southern California, and its headquarters in San Francisco. Anyone can work for a .com for dollars. We have several hundred active projects at any given time, with an impact that ranges from schools to state departments of education to the federal government. WestEd Interactive, the organization's technology group, has supported over 100 projects in the last few years, and is one of the country’s largest not-for-profit development teams in the educational industry.
